你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

Lineage - Get Lineage By Unique Attribute

返回有关实体的世系信息。

除了 typeName 路径参数,还可以使用以下格式提供属性键值对 ()

attr:[attrName]=[attrValue]

注意:attrName 和 attrValue 在实体之间应是唯一的,例如。qualifiedName

GET {Endpoint}/catalog/api/atlas/v2/lineage/uniqueAttribute/type/{typeName}?direction={direction}
GET {Endpoint}/catalog/api/atlas/v2/lineage/uniqueAttribute/type/{typeName}?depth={depth}&width={width}&direction={direction}&includeParent={includeParent}&getDerivedLineage={getDerivedLineage}

URI 参数

Name In Required Type Description
Endpoint
path True
  • string

Purview 帐户的目录终结点。 示例:https://{accountName}.purview.azure.com

typeName
path True
  • string

类型的名称。

direction
query True

世系的方向,可以是 INPUT、OUTPUT 或 BOTH。

depth
query
  • integer
int32

世系的跃点数。

getDerivedLineage
query
  • boolean

如此 以在响应中包含派生世系

includeParent
query
  • boolean

如此 以在响应中包含父链。

width
query
  • integer
int32

世系中最大扩展宽度的数目。

响应

Name Type Description
200 OK

如果给定实体存在世系

400 Bad Request

错误的查询参数

404 Not Found

如果未找到给定实体的世系

安全性

azure_auth

Azure Active Directory OAuth2 Flow。

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Name Description
user_impersonation 模拟用户帐户

定义

AtlasLineageInfo

AtlasLineageInfo

direction

世系的方向,可以是 INPUT、OUTPUT 或 BOTH。

LineageDirection

LineageDirection

LineageRelation

LineageRelation

ParentRelation

ParentRelation

AtlasLineageInfo

AtlasLineageInfo

Name Type Description
baseEntityGuid
  • string

基实体的 GUID。

childrenCount
  • integer

子节点数。

guidEntityMap
  • object

GUID 实体映射。

includeParent
  • boolean

如此 返回基实体的父级。

lineageDepth
  • integer

世系深度。

lineageDirection

LineageDirection
世系方向的枚举。

lineageWidth
  • integer

世系的宽度。

parentRelations

父关系数组。

relations

世系关系的数组。

widthCounts
  • object

特定方向的实体计数。

direction

世系的方向,可以是 INPUT、OUTPUT 或 BOTH。

Name Type Description
BOTH
  • string
INPUT
  • string
OUTPUT
  • string

LineageDirection

LineageDirection

Name Type Description
BOTH
  • string
INPUT
  • string
OUTPUT
  • string

LineageRelation

LineageRelation

Name Type Description
fromEntityId
  • string

from-entity 的 GUID。

relationshipId
  • string

关系的 GUID。

toEntityId
  • string

到实体的 GUID。

ParentRelation

ParentRelation

Name Type Description
childEntityId
  • string

子实体的 GUID。

parentEntityId
  • string

父实体的 GUID。

relationshipId
  • string

关系的 GUID。